Stalley Goes on the Offensive in "Raise Your Weapon" Video

The Ohio rapper offers a powerful message for his latest visuals.

Stalley releases his music video for "Raise Your Weapon." The video is directed by Abraham Vilchez-Moran and Jai Jamison and offers a few different story lines that touch on racial injustice in America. One that's prominent throughout the clip is an African American teenager who gets locked for, as it appears, standing on a street and eating Skittles. We then witness him being thrown into jail. While it's not clarified in "Raise Your Weapon," the inclusion of Skittles is likely a reference to the tragic death of Trayvon Martin. The 17-year-old Floridian was shot and killed in February of 2012 by George Zimmerman. At the time Martin had a bag of Skittles and an Arizona Iced Tea on him. Either way, these are powerful visuals from the MMG rapper.

"Raise Your Weapon" is included on Stalley's latest mixtape Honest Cowboy which is available now.
